Bring Back Welford Postman Pat

Welford's Postman Pat was a much loved local landmark on the roadside of the High Street A5199 until he sadly rotted away and collapsed in early 2019.  Carved out of an old tree, he and his cat Jess had been part of Welford since the 1990s.
The local community mourned his passing, and following an appeal in the Welford Bugle a small group of residents  formed a group to bring him back.  The group wants to commission a new Postman Pat wooden carving to match the original and erect it in the same place on the roadside verge just up the hill from the pocket park.  
The new carving will be designed to last, carved from hard wood and mounted on a concrete base.
